How to Find the Convex Hull of All Integer Points in a Polyhedron? (2010.13147v1)

Published 25 Oct 2020 in math.CO, cs.CG, and math.OC

Abstract: We propose a cut-based algorithm for finding all vertices and all facets of the convex hull of all integer points of a polyhedron defined by a system of linear inequalities. Our algorithm DDM Cuts is based on the Gomory cuts and the dynamic version of the double description method. We describe the computer implementation of the algorithm and present the results of computational experiments comparing our algorithm with a naive one.
